Mrs. Brandreth Gibbs, of Leigh-On-Sea

Mrs. Brandreth Gibbs, who died on 19th December last, at the age of eighty-eight, became a Life-boat worker more than sixty years ago. As far back as 1869 she was presented with a framed photograph for her work in connexion with an appeal at Exeter.

Mrs. Brandreth Gibbs's interest in the Institution continued right through her long life. In 1918 she undertook the organisation of the Life-boat Day at Leigh-On-Sea for the Southend-on-Sea Branch, and continued this work, with great enthusiasm and success, for eight years, until obliged by serious illness to give it up in 1926. She was then awarded the Gold Brooch, which is given only for long and exceptional services..
